The is a historic house located at 406 Main Street in , . The house was the home of Susan Wissler, the mayor of Dayton from 1911 to 1914; Wissler was the first female mayor in Wyoming and one of the first in the United States. is situated 2 miles southeast of Mock Ditch Number 2.
